Google abandons plan to remove cookies from Chrome browser

  • Google will keep third-party cookies in its Chrome browser after years of plans to remove them, as announced on Monday.
  • This reversal is due to advertisers' concerns about losing the ability to collect data for personalized ads.
  • Anthony Chavez stated they would introduce a new option for users to control their cookie choices while browsing.
